1.21.2010 | Football
2009 marked the best season in Maritime football history, as fifth-year head coach Clayton Kendrick-Holmes and his staff led the squad to their first winning season ever. The Privateers finished the year with a 6-4 mark (3-3 ECFC) and were one win away from the Eastern Collegiate Football Conference championship game.

11.13.2009 | Football
The Maritime football team had a conference-best 13 players named to the all-ECFC post season teams, as announced by conference officials on Friday. The Privateers had five members named to the all-conference first teams (three on offense and two on defense), while leading all conference school with eight players on the all-ECFC second team (three on offense and five on defense). In addition, three players were also named all-conference honorable mentions.

11.6.2009 | Football
The Maritime football team lost its season-finale to Gallaudet in the final minute of play Friday night at Reinhart Field. The Bison scored the game-winning touchdown with 53 second left on the clock and held off the ensuing Privateer drive for the victory. With the loss, Maritime ends the season with a 6-4 overall record and a 3-3 mark in the ECFC, while the Bison also move to 6-4 overall and finish third in the conference with a 3-2 mark.

Athletes of the Week
Caroline Hickey
Women's Swimming
Maritime College junior Caroline Hickey captured the top spot in two races in a meet against Skyline Conference opponents Old Westbury and St. Joseph’s Tuesday night. She won the 200-yard individual medley with a time of 2:34.26, five seconds faster than the next swimmer. She then won the 100-yard backstroke in 1:10.41. Hickey was also part of a 200-yard medley relay team that came in second with a time of 2:14.64.
